Find the Secret Switch Before You Call the Repairman

According to a study by Consumer Reports, the complexity of modern smart appliances means software glitches are now a top reason for user frustration and unnecessary service calls. If your touchscreen is unresponsive or you need to reset your smart fridge after a power outage, you don’t need a toolbox. You just need to know where the manufacturers hide the ‘brain’ of the machine. Usually, it’s a pinhole button or a small toggle switch often found near the top hinge or inside the filter compartment. Is a simple reset actually going to save my groceries?

I get the skepticism. When your fridge is making a loud humming sound or the ice maker is totally silent, a tiny button seems like a band-aid on a bullet wound. But here is the truth: modern fridges often get stuck in a ‘loop’ during a software update or after a minor voltage spike. A hard reset forces the sensors to re-calibrate. It’s the same reason we restart our laptops when the Wi-Fi acts up. Hunt for the Master Toggle

The master toggle is rarely out in the open. On several units I’ve worked on, it’s hidden behind a small plastic panel on the top of the right-hand door hinge. I once spent forty minutes frantically searching for one of these while my unit was stuck in a loop, only to realize the switch was behind the magnetic seal. When you find it, flip it to the ‘Off’ position and wait at least sixty seconds. This allows the capacitors on the motherboard to fully discharge. This is the same logic used when you reset your smart fridge after a power outage to ensure the sensors don’t get a false reading from a lingering charge.

When the Software Just Won’t Listen

If the physical switch doesn’t bring the screen back to life, you’re likely dealing with a frozen operating system. This is often why your smart fridge screen keeps going black every morning—it’s trying to run a background update and failing. To force a software reboot without losing your settings, locate the ‘Home’ and ‘Help’ buttons (or the equivalent volume up/down buttons on some models) and hold them simultaneously for ten seconds. You’ll know it worked when the manufacturer’s logo appears. Why does my new fridge run almost 90% of the time?

If you’ve upgraded recently, you probably noticed a constant, low-frequency hum. Old-school fridges were binary—they were either ‘on’ at 100% power or completely ‘off.’ Modern smart units use variable-speed inverter compressors that stay on at a low speed to maintain a perfectly stable internal climate. It’s actually more energy-efficient than the old start-stop cycle, but it can be jarring for owners of refrigerators in 2025 who expect silence. Trust the Turbidity Sensors Over Your Instincts

The most common mistake I see advanced users make is ‘pre-rinsing’ dishes to a surgical shine before putting them in the dishwasher. Modern units are equipped with turbidity sensors that ‘see’ how dirty the water is during the initial rinse. If you provide the machine with clean dishes, the sensor tells the computer to run a shorter, cooler cycle. Because the enzymes in modern detergent need food particles to react with, the soap has nothing to latch onto and ends up scouring your plates instead of cleaning them. This is often why your dishwasher isn’t drying the dishes well—the cycle ended too early because you were too helpful. The Small Tool Kit That Saves Me Thousands

My most used tool isn’t a wrench; it’s a simple multimeter. If you can check for continuity, you can solve half of your own problems. For example, if you’re wondering the real reason your ice maker is producing tiny hollow cubes, it’s often a failing water inlet valve. A quick test with a meter tells me if the part is dead before I spend $80 on a replacement. I also swear by using the best smart plugs for monitoring appliance energy use. These aren’t just for turning lamps on; they act as an early warning system. If my washer starts drawing 20% more power than usual for a standard cycle, I know a bearing is starting to seize long before the machine throws an error code.
